Light­gui­des for Mixed Rea­lity Glas­ses • Design Tech­ni­ques and Challenges

The use of light­gui­des with dif­frac­tion gra­tings has become of great inte­rest in the deve­lo­p­ment of aug­men­ted rea­lity and mixed rea­lity glas­ses. The pro­pa­ga­tion of light through such light­gui­des requi­res simu­la­tion tech­ni­ques bey­ond ray tra­cing. It must be pos­si­ble to include phy­si­cal-optics effects in a con­troll­able man­ner to meet the needs in mode­ling and design. This web­i­nar will intro­duce you to a sui­ta­ble phy­si­cal-optics mode­ling tech­no­logy and demons­trate it in the soft­ware Vir­tual­Lab Fusion.

The web­i­nar will also address the chal­lenges in the design of such light­gui­des with dif­fe­rent lay­outs and archi­tec­tures. Light­guide design for AR/MR con­sti­tu­tes an emer­ging tech­no­logy. Some of the tech­ni­cal chal­lenges are unders­tood and sol­ved. Others remain to be inves­ti­ga­ted and hurd­les need to be over­come. Sui­ta­ble mode­ling and design tech­ni­ques, as well as soft­ware, are indis­pensable for fur­ther pro­gress. Prof. Dr. Frank Wyrow­ski (Foun­der): Frank Wyrow­ski co-foun­ded the com­pany Light­Trans in 1999 and the com­pany Wyrow­ski Pho­to­nics in 2014. He has been pro­fes­sor of tech­ni­cal phy­sics at the Fried­rich Schil­ler Uni­ver­sity of Jena and head of the Applied Com­pu­ta­tio­nal Optics Group since 1996. His work as entre­pre­neur, rese­ar­cher, and tea­cher is dedi­ca­ted to deve­lo­ping fast phy­si­cal-optics tech­ni­ques and soft­ware to address the incre­asing demand to over­come the limi­ta­ti­ons of ray optics in modern optics and pho­to­nics appli­ca­ti­ons. Cus­to­mers world­wide bene­fit from his enga­ge­ment through the com­pa­nies’ con­sul­ting and engi­nee­ring ser­vices, and the com­mer­cial opti­cal design soft­ware, Vir­tual­Lab Fusion. Cur­rent R&D topics include appli­ca­ti­ons such as light­gui­des for AR and VR, light sha­ping, micro­scopy, inter­fe­ro­me­try, fiber cou­pling, dif­frac­tive and meta len­ses, DOE, HOE, free­form, micro­lens arrays, and phy­si­cal optics theory in general.
